在Angular2中获取select选项,可以通过以下步骤实现:
<select [(ngModel)]="selectedOption">
<option value="option1">Option 1</option>
<option value="option2">Option 2</option>
<option value="option3">Option 3</option>
</select>
export class MyComponent {
selectedOption: string;
}
import { Component, ViewChild, ElementRef } from '@angular/core';
export class MyComponent {
@ViewChild('mySelect') mySelect: ElementRef;
getSelectedOptionText() {
const selectedOption = this.mySelect.nativeElement.selectedOptions[0];
const selectedOptionText = selectedOption.textContent;
console.log(selectedOptionText);
}
}
<select #mySelect [(ngModel)]="selectedOption">
<option value="option1">Option 1</option>
<option value="option2">Option 2</option>
<option value="option3">Option 3</option>
</select>
这是在Angular2中获取select选项的基本步骤。根据具体需求,你可以进一步处理选项的值和文本内容,以满足你的业务逻辑。
领取专属 10元无门槛券
手把手带您无忧上云